Choose materials that balance drainage, load-bearing, and local availability. For driveways and high-traffic areas, pick aggregates that compact well and resist rutting; for planting beds and grading, prefer materials that improve drainage and soil structure. Because Hello Gravel sources regionally, texture and color can vary, so request guidance or samples if appearance matters.
Freeze-thaw and seasonal rain can cause settling, frost heave, and washout of loose materials. Proper base preparation, compaction, and good surface drainage reduce these risks. Plan deliveries for drier periods when possible and expect some settling after the first winter, which may need topping or regrading.
Monessen's river valley terrain and sloped lots can create runoff and erosion challenges, and some yards may have heavy clay or poorly draining soils. Choose materials and installation methods that promote drainage and stabilize slopes, such as coarser aggregates, geotextile underlayment, or larger stone for erosion control. Incorporate proper grading and drainage channels to protect surfaces and plantings.

Clear a safe access route for a dump truck, remove obstacles and loose debris, and mark the intended drop location with visible flags. Call 811 to have underground utilities located and ensure the drop area can support heavy truck weight. If you need spreading, request tailgate service at checkout and be prepared that the driver will assess whether it can be done safely.
Permeable surfaces let water soak through, reducing runoff and helping with heavy rain, but they can shift more with freeze-thaw cycles if not properly installed. Solid surfaces are more stable under traffic but need a well-designed base and frost protection to avoid cracking or heaving. Choose based on drainage needs, maintenance willingness, and intended use.
Lifespan varies by material and installation: loose aggregates may need topping or regrading every few years, while well-compacted bases can last much longer. Routine maintenance includes releveling, adding material after settling, weed control, and checking drainage features after heavy rain or winter. Local freeze-thaw cycles tend to increase maintenance frequency compared with milder climates.
Measure the area (length x width) and decide on depth in inches, then use a material calculator to convert cubic yards to tons. Hello Gravel provides an online calculator and a support team that can verify quantities if you share your dimensions. Ordering slightly more than calculated helps account for compaction and minor grading changes.
Local contractors typically emphasize solid subgrade preparation, proper compaction, and correct slope for drainage. They often recommend geotextile fabric on poor soils, a compacted base layer for driveways, and using progressively smaller aggregates for a stable surface.
